The Role

Join a committed, forward‑thinking team delivering high‑quality teaching and training across a diverse range of audiology programmes. We’re looking for someone with strong expertise in adult aural diagnostics and rehabilitation, alongside specialist knowledge in auditory anatomy and physiology and/or acoustics.

A major part of the role involves being a core member of our academic placement team, working closely with students and placement providers to ensure excellent clinical learning experiences and strong professional partnerships.

You’ll play a key role in shaping the learning experience for our students — contributing to established programmes, helping design new modules, and supporting the development of innovative short courses.

Our Audiology section is one of the largest and best‑equipped in the UK, featuring state‑of‑the‑art clinical facilities and cutting‑edge technology. The role also offers exciting opportunities to engage in enterprise activity, consultancy, and research.
